AMENDMENT TO CATALOGUE A Charles I amulet marked lion passant sinister for Newcastle circa 1600/1650, modelled as a profile of Charles I , well chased and engraved, plain loop suspension Height: 53mm, weight: 30g Originally purchased from F E Norwood Ltd, in April 1968 for £200. The receipt stating there is a similar amulet appearing in a painting of Sir Daniel Goodright dated 1634 in York Art Gallery, it is also illustrated in the connoisseur book The Stuart Period. Certainly a rare item for both collectors with an interest in Charles I and collectors of Newcastle silver.

*Pair of sixth-plate ambrotypes of a young husband and wife, by Henry Boswell Lee (or Joseph Lee), 57 Church Street, Liverpool, c. 1860, in leather cases with photographer's embossed stamp to lids, together with a tinted sixth-plate ambrotype of a seated woman, by J. Wilkinson, Photographer, 17 Sheffield Moor, late 1850s, embossed case with floral design to lid and bearing gilt embossed details to base, plus a sixth-plate ambrotype of a seated young gentleman by Beard & Foard, 14 St Ann's Square, Manchester & 34 Church Street, Liverpool, late 1850s, plain leather case with gilt embossed photographer details to base Henry Lee had been a fabric retailer until retirement in 1857 when he took up photography and opened a studio with his brother Joseph. His brother was the artist John Ingle Lee. Henry's other two sons George and Henry established the famous Liverpool department store of George Henry Lee. Hannavy, Case Histories, p. 42 (last item). (4)
